Cascon is a luxury holiday lodge in St. Asaph, Denbighshire, North Wales. This high-spec 4-bedroom retreat offers exceptional comfort with underfloor heating, smart TVs and top-notch furnishings throughout. The owners clearly didn't shop at IKEA for this place – everything screams quality.
Set in beautiful North Wales, you're perfectly positioned to explore the stunning Clwydian Range and Dee Valley. The Plough pub is within walking distance – great for those evenings when cooking feels like too much effort after a day in the hot tub. There's a children's park nearby too, perfect for tiring out the little monsters before bedtime.
The accommodation sleeps 8 guests across 4 bedrooms: a king-size with free-standing bath and en-suite shower, a ground-floor double (brilliant for grandparents who can't do stairs), another double and a twin room. The open-plan living space includes a fully-equipped kitchen with electric double oven, hob, microwave, fridge/freezer and dishwasher. There's also a separate snug for when you need to escape your family.
Visit Prestatyn Central Beach (15 minutes), Rhyl Beach (20 minutes), Denbigh Castle (15 minutes), or the quirky Cae Dai 1950s Museum (20 minutes). All offer fantastic day trips without spending half your holiday in the car.
The enclosed garden with hot tub is where you'll spend most evenings – glass of wine in hand, stargazing, wondering why you don't live at Cascon permanently.

To reach Cascon by car, follow directions to St. Asaph in Denbighshire. The property is easily accessible from major routes including the A55 North Wales Expressway which connects to the UK motorway network.
For rail travelers, the nearest station is Rhyl, approximately 7 miles away. From there, you'll need to take a short taxi ride to the property in St. Asaph.
